Transaction ab73eaedf31fb2a5ee722538331055f38063bd5270d32cdba344c73e401d66ea

4 Input
2 Outputs
  • ab73eaedf31fb2a5ee722538331055f38063bd5270d32cdba344c73e401d66ea:0
  • value  1597545
    address  17FTLhAfE4teEA1nFPDh84657ed4dGmwZK
  • ab73eaedf31fb2a5ee722538331055f38063bd5270d32cdba344c73e401d66ea:1
  • value  999155
    address  1Aau92kS2qiyBndq3aLzzNE6XExx9BuBGc